CNA HealthPro, a leader in the healthcare professional liability
industry, recently collaborated with the Nurses Service Organization
(NSO) to publish Understanding Nurse Practitioner Liability: CNA
HealthPro Nurse Practitioner Claims Analysis 1998-2008, Risk Management
Strategies and Highlights of the 2009 NSO Survey. Using CNA
HealthPro claims data and NSO’s
survey of nurse practitioners, the document is designed to help this
group of medical professionals recognize medical malpractice risks,
understand the current legal and regulatory environment, and implement
risk management strategies to prevent patient injuries.

Through its collaboration with the NSO, CNA HealthPro currently insures
approximately 25,000 nurse practitioners nationwide. In addition to
analyzing reported events from CNA-insured nurse practitioners and
providing results of the NSO survey, the collaborative claims review
includes the following highlights:
-
ultimate average indemnity and expense payments have increased over
the past 10 years; the average appears to be increasing at a rate of
2.3 percent per year;
-
the medical care office is the location with the highest number of
claims;
-
adult/geriatric, family and pediatric/neonatal medicine specialties
continue to have the most claims;
-
pediatric/neonatal specialty has the highest average severity; and
-
several closed claims that settled at the policy limit (i.e., $1
million) resulted from allegations of failure to diagnose or failure
to properly assess.
